Ali Kemal (7 September 1869 – 6 November 1922) was a Turkish journalist, politician and writer who served as the Minister of the Interior of the Ottoman Empire in 1919 under the government of Grand Vizier Damat Ferid Pasha. Ideologically an Ottoman liberal, he was lynched by Nureddin Pasha's paramilitary officers for his opposition to the Turkish National Movement following Turkish victory in the Greco-Turkish War. Kemal is the father of Zeki Kuneralp, who was the former Turkish ambassador in Switzerland, the United Kingdom, and Spain. In addition, he is the paternal grandfather of both the Turkish diplomat Selim Kuneralp, and the British politician Stanley Johnson. Read more on Wikipedia
